I'm not a big horse racing guy. I take my kids there a few times a year because they really enjoy it. Some of the other real horsemen on the board might have been there and can give you a better review.

It's a nice place to kill a night though. The viewing boxes have ample seating so you can go there with a big group and have some space of your own. The beers and the like are pretty reasonably priced. My kids like it because there are opportunities to view the horses at close proximity, and they enjoy picking horses to win the race.

It's never been obscenely crowded and always easy to place a bet, get food/drink. It's a really affordable experience for someone of any age really. I'd recommend it to anyone who lives in the Houston metro area, even if to just give it a try. Their concert series used to get a real nice list performers, but I've never been for that.
